We are seeking an experienced Senior Cloud Deployment Engineer to join our team and take charge of deploying and maintaining cloud solutions within our enterprise.
This role involves collaborating with cross-functional teams to deliver high-quality and efficient cloud infrastructure according to both project and operational requirements.
Responsibilities
- Lead the deployment and configuration of AWS AppStream 2.0 and Virtual Desktop Infrastructure (VDI)
- Automate infrastructure provisioning and management tasks using Terraform and Python
- Design and implement CI/CD pipelines using Azure DevOps
- Manage and optimize Amazon Web Services (AWS) resources efficiently
- Monitor and ensure the reliability and performance of the cloud infrastructure
- Develop and maintain technical documentation related to cloud deployment processes
- Ensure compliance with security standards and best practices
- Troubleshoot and resolve complex technical issues in cloud deployments
- Collaborate with developers, system admins, and other stakeholders for smooth operations
- Stay up-to-date with emerging cloud technologies and trends
Requirements
- At least 3 years of experience in cloud deployment engineering or related roles
- Expertise in AWS, Azure DevOps, and Virtual Desktop Infrastructure
- Proficiency in Terraform and Python scripting for automation
- Background in managing and configuring AWS AppStream 2.0
- Capability to design and implement scalable and secure cloud infrastructure
- Understanding of best practices in cloud security and compliance
- Strong problem-solving skills and ability to think strategically
- Excellent communication and collaboration skills
Nice to have
- Familiarity with Azure VMware Solutions
- Skills in Bash and PowerShell scripting
- Experience with GitHub for source control
- Knowledge of Node.js for backend services
Benefits
- International projects with top brands
- Work with global teams of highly skilled, diverse peers
- Healthcare benefits
- Employee financial programs
- Paid time off and sick leave
- Upskilling, reskilling and certification courses
- Unlimited access to the LinkedIn Learning library and 22,000+ courses
- Global career opportunities
- Volunteer and community involvement opportunities
- EPAM Employee Groups
-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n